Catholic Online (Project of Your Catholic Voice Foundation) (Saint Martin de Porres; born December 9, 1579 in Lima, Peru; feast day is November 3; patron of mixed race, barbers, public health workers, and innkeepers; illegitimate son to a Spanish gentlemen and a freed slave from Panama, of African or possibly Native American descent; at a young age, Martin's father abandoned him, his mother and his younger sister, leaving Martin to grow up in deep poverty; after spending just two years in primary school, he was placed with a barber/surgeon where he would learn to cut hair and the medical arts; when he was 15, he asked for admission into the Dominican Convent of the Rosary in Lima and was received as a servant boy and eventually was moved up to the church officer in charge of distributing money to deserving poor; became a Dominican lay brother in 1603 at the age of 24; ten years later, after he had been presented with the religious habit of a lay brother, Martin was assigned to the infirmary where he would remain in charge until his death on November 3, 1639 at the Dominican Convent of the Rosary; beatified in 1837 by Pope Gregory XVI; canonized in 1962 by Pope John XXIII) https://www.catholic.org/saints/saint.php?saint_id=306

Encyclopaedia Britannica' website, May 13, 2021: (St. Martín de Porres; Juan Martín de Porres Velázquez; born 1579, Lima, Peru; died November 3, 1639, Lima; canonized 1962; feast day November 3; Peruvian friar noted for his kindness, his nursing of the sick, his obedience, and his charity; patron saint of social justice, racial harmony, and mixed-race people) https://www.britannica.com/biography/Saint-Martin-de-Porres
